Dear TRAI, 
		I am writing to express my concern against the actions that telecom 
carriers are taking to restrict fair access to the internet (Net Neutrality). 
I believe the internet is a vital resource – it helps me communicate, work, 
and thrive as a citizen. If telecom operators can discriminate internet traffic 
on the basis of which services pay the most, we are allowing telcos control 
over a vital and necessary technological resource. By doing so we allow them 
to define what information we can view; what entertainment we can access; and 
how companies can innovate.

This is completely unfair and harms India’s long term role in the global 
market. I strongly believe the growth of telecoms and the well-being of the 
internet can go hand-in-hand. I’m asking for a framework to ensure long term 
and fair access for all services regardless of size. I want my generation and 
those that come after me to have unfettered access to the Internet, with no 
telcos or ISPs having the ability to charge for specific services I use on top 
of it. Please understand that the internet is an important resource and vital 
to me and to every other Indian citizen. I would like to see it kept free and 
protected under Net Neutrality to ensure fair and equal access for all and 
forever.
